public class FrontalKeypointEnriched extends AbstractMetaFaceDetector implements TechnicalInformationHandler
@inproceedings{Everingham2006, author = {Mark Everingham and Josef Sivic and Andrew Zisserman}, booktitle = {In BMVC}, title = {Hello! My name is... Buffy - Automatic naming of characters in TV video}, year = {2006} }
-logging-level <OFF|SEVERE|WARNING|INFO|CONFIG|FINE|FINER|FINEST> (property: loggingLevel) The logging level for outputting errors and debugging output. default: WARNING
-detector <adams.data.openimaj.facedetector.AbstractFaceDetector> (property: detector) The base detector to use. default: adams.data.openimaj.facedetector.HaarCascade
-patch-scale <float> (property: patchScale) The scale of the patch compared to the patch extracted by the internal detector. default: 1.0 minimum: 0.0
Modifier and Type | Field and Description |
---|---|
protected float |
m_PatchScale
the scale of the patch compared to the patch extracted by the internal detector.
|
m_Detector
m_ActualDetector
m_OptionManager
m_Logger, m_LoggingIsEnabled, m_LoggingLevel
Constructor and Description |
---|
FrontalKeypointEnriched() |
Modifier and Type | Method and Description |
---|---|
protected org.openimaj.image.Image |
convert(AbstractImageContainer cont)
Converts the image container into the required image type for the detector.
|
void |
defineOptions()
Adds options to the internal list of options.
|
protected AbstractFaceDetector |
getDefaultDetector()
Returns the default detector to use.
|
float |
getPatchScale()
Returns the scale of the patch compared to the patch extracted by the
internal detector.
|
TechnicalInformation |
getTechnicalInformation()
Returns an instance of a TechnicalInformation object, containing
detailed information about the technical background of this class,
e.g., paper reference or book this class is based on.
|
String |
globalInfo()
Returns a string describing the object.
|
protected org.openimaj.image.processing.face.detection.FaceDetector |
newInstance()
Creates a new instance of the face detector.
|
String |
patchScaleTipText()
Returns the tip text for this property.
|
void |
setPatchScale(float value)
Sets the scale of the patch compared to the patch extracted by the
internal detector.
|
detectorTipText, getDetector, setDetector
detectFaces, reset
cleanUpOptions, destroy, finishInit, getDefaultLoggingLevel, getOptionManager, initialize, loggingLevelTipText, newOptionManager, setLoggingLevel, toCommandLine, toString
configureLogger, getLogger, getLoggingLevel, initializeLogging, isLoggingEnabled, sizeOf
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
getLoggingLevel
protected float m_PatchScale
public String globalInfo()
AbstractOptionHandler
globalInfo
in interface GlobalInfoSupporter
globalInfo
in class AbstractOptionHandler
public TechnicalInformation getTechnicalInformation()
getTechnicalInformation
in interface TechnicalInformationHandler
public void defineOptions()
defineOptions
in interface OptionHandler
defineOptions
in class AbstractMetaFaceDetector
protected AbstractFaceDetector getDefaultDetector()
getDefaultDetector
in class AbstractMetaFaceDetector
public void setPatchScale(float value)
value
- the scalepublic float getPatchScale()
public String patchScaleTipText()
protected org.openimaj.image.processing.face.detection.FaceDetector newInstance()
newInstance
in class AbstractFaceDetector
protected org.openimaj.image.Image convert(AbstractImageContainer cont)
convert
in class AbstractFaceDetector
cont
- the container to convertCopyright © 2021 University of Waikato, Hamilton, NZ. All Rights Reserved.